Exploring the Mind: Understanding Psychedelics

 

Before delving into the potential benefits, it is crucial to understand what psychedelics are and how they work. Psychedelics are a class of substances that profoundly alter an individual's perception, cognition, and emotions. These substances include LSD (lysergic acid diethylamide), psilocybin (found in certain mushrooms), and DMT (dimethyltryptamine), among others.

 

When consumed, psychedelics interact with specific receptors in the brain, leading to an altered state of consciousness. This altered state can result in enhanced introspection, synesthesia (a blending of the senses), and profound experiences of interconnectedness. These profound experiences have the potential to be transformative and have lasting positive effects.

 

Harnessing the Power of Psychedelics for Mental Health

 

In recent years, researchers have shone a light on the therapeutic potential of psychedelics, particularly in the treatment of mental health disorders such as depression, anxiety, and PTSD (post-traumatic stress disorder). Clinical trials have shown promising results, with many participants reporting significant reductions in symptoms and an overall improvement in their quality of life.

 

The therapeutic use of psychedelics often takes place in a carefully controlled and supportive environment, guided by trained professionals. These professionals help individuals navigate their psychedelic experiences, providing a safe space for introspection and personal growth. It is worth noting that these therapies are not intended for recreational use and should always be approached with caution and respect.

 

Key Benefits and Potential Applications of Psychedelics

 

1. Breaking Patterns: Psychedelics have shown potential in breaking repetitive thought patterns and facilitating new perspectives. By disrupting entrenched neural pathways, they offer individuals an opportunity to explore alternative ways of thinking and behaving, opening doors to personal growth and transformation.

 

2. Enhanced Creativity: Many artists, musicians, and writers have reported using psychedelics as a catalyst for creativity. These substances can unlock new pathways of imagination and inspire creativity, leading to innovative ideas and fresh perspectives.

 

3. Increased Empathy and Connectedness: Psychedelics often evoke a sense of interconnectedness with others and the world around us. This heightened empathy can promote compassion, understanding, and a deeper appreciation of our shared humanity.

 

4. Reducing Existential Anxiety: Research suggests that psychedelics may help individuals confront existential anxiety and gain a greater sense of purpose and meaning in life. By facilitating a deeper understanding of oneself and one's place in the world, these substances may alleviate the distress often associated with existential questions.

 

Guidelines for Safe and Responsible Use

 

While the potential benefits of psychedelics are groundbreaking, it is imperative to emphasize responsible use and harm reduction. Here are some guidelines for those considering exploring the use of psychedelics:

 

1. Set and Setting: Create a comfortable and safe environment for the experience. Choose a time when you feel emotionally stable and have a trusted companion who can provide support if needed.

 

2. Education: Research and educate yourself about the substance you intend to consume. Understand its risks, effects, and potential interactions with any medications you may be taking.

 

3. Integration: After the experience, take time to reflect, integrate, and make sense of the insights gained. Integration can occur through journaling, therapy, or conversations with trusted individuals.

 

4. Professional Guidance: If considering psychedelic-assisted therapy, seek out trained professionals who can guide you through the experience and provide appropriate support.
